PRIVACY ACT Information Regarding
the Privacy Act
Why we ask for your information.
We ask you for information to establish and service you. The
information we ask for depends on which product or service you use. For
every product or service, we need your name, address and some
identification. We only collect the information we need and only use if
for the purposes explained to you. Here's why we need some of the other
information we ask for.
1. Birth Date This helps us identify you and ensure that no
one is trying to impersonate you. We may also use it to determine your
eligibility for products and services that may be of benefit to a
particular age group.
2. Social Insurance Number (SIN) Your SIN is required for
products which earn investment income, in order to comply with Revenue
Canada's Income reporting requirements. We also use it to keep your
information separate from that of other customers with a similar name.
This may include information we obtain with your consent through the
credit approval process.
3. Financial Information This is used to assess your
eligibility for credit products such as loans. We also use it to ensure
that the advice we give you is appropriate for you.
4. Health Information This is required for some insurance
products to ensure you are eligible for coverage.
When you apply for a new product or service, we
will indicate in the application or agreement how we intend to use your
information. If we need to use it for another purpose, we will ask you
for your consent at that time.
